Where You'll Come In

The Manager for Veterinary and Scientific Communications is responsible for owning, developing and improving nutritional & medical content. They ensure our internal and external nutritional and medical communications are accurate, appropriate, timely, engaging and a value-add for lay audiences, pro audiences and internal teams. This person will oversee content development on all fronts and verify its medical accuracy.

How You'll Make An Impact

  • You will be the go to in-house nutritional medical expert 
  • Create webinars, continuing education and additional presentation material
  • Build out all medical algorithms, guidelines, and nutritional advice for our veterinary professional portal 
  • Work with R&D on studies and new products
  • Work with our internal team to edit and design nutritional content for veterinary professionals 
  • Work with Customer Experience to help develop their training materials around nutrition 
  • Work with Engineering and other teams on any algorithms or required changes to our feeding structures
  • Work with all customer facing content teams to ensure medical and nutritional accuracy on outbound content

We're Excited About You Because

  • You have a DACVIM (Nutrition) certification or are residency-trained and eligible to sit for your DACVIM (Nutrition) boards
